EdTrust has 4 state offices: EdTrust-Midwest, EdTrust-New York, EdTrust-West, and EdTrust-Tennessee. The state offices advocate for educational justice and the high academic achievement of all students, pre-k through college, particularly students of color and students from low-income backgrounds, in their respective states.GeographiesNot indicatedDatesJul 1, 2023 – Jun 30, 2024Source990No causes providedNo populations provided–$15.2M
